The JDS Uniphase SWS16102 is a source optics module engineered for integration into the JDS Swept Wavelength System (SWS). It generates stable, accurate optical signals for DWDM component testing, optical network characterization, and precise wavelength measurements. The module features an integrated calibration reference to maintain high wavelength accuracy and delivers optical power through four FC/APC connectors with low insertion loss. Available in C-Band and L-Band variants to address different spectral regions.
## Technical Specifications
• **Product Type:** Source Optics Module
• **System:** Component of the JDS Swept Wavelength System (SWS)
• **C-Band Wavelength Coverage:** 1525–1565 nm
• **L-Band Variant:** Available (wavelength range per L-Band specification)
• **Optical Connectors:** FC/APC (four outputs on C-Band variant)
• **Calibration:** Integrated wavelength reference for accuracy maintenance

## Compatibility & Integration
The SWS16102 integrates with the JDS Uniphase SWS16100 System and other JDS Swept Wavelength System platforms, functioning as a modular source component within larger optical test architectures.
